P0506 Audi Code: Understanding and Fixing Low Idle RPM Issues

The P0506 trouble code is a common issue that Audi owners may encounter, indicating a problem with the idle control system. Specifically, it means the engine’s revolutions per minute (RPM) are lower than expected at idle. This can lead to a rough idle, engine stalling, and other performance issues. If you’re experiencing a P0506 code in your Audi, understanding the potential causes and troubleshooting steps is crucial for effective repair.

Understanding the P0506 Code

The P0506 code, as defined by OBD-II standards, signifies “Idle Control System RPM Lower Than Expected.” In Audi vehicles, this code is triggered when the engine control unit (ECU) detects that the engine’s idle speed is below the programmed target RPM. The idle control system is designed to maintain a steady engine speed when no throttle input is applied, ensuring smooth operation and preventing stalling.

Several components work together to regulate idle speed, including:

  • Throttle Body: Controls the amount of air entering the engine.
  • Idle Air Control (IAC) Valve or System: In some older systems, an IAC valve directly regulates air bypass for idle. Modern Audis often use electronic throttle bodies for idle control.
  • Mass Air Flow (MAF) Sensor: Measures the amount of air entering the engine, crucial for fuel mixture calculations.
  • Crankshaft Position Sensor and Camshaft Position Sensor: Monitor engine timing and speed.
  • Engine Control Unit (ECU): The brain of the engine management system, monitoring sensor data and controlling actuators to maintain optimal engine performance, including idle speed.
  • Positive Crankcase Ventilation (PCV) System: Manages engine blow-by gases and can affect idle if malfunctioning.
  • Vacuum System: Vacuum leaks can disrupt the air-fuel mixture and idle stability.

When the ECU detects that the idle RPM is too low, it sets the P0506 code and may illuminate the check engine light.

Common Symptoms of P0506 in Audi Vehicles

Besides the check engine light, other symptoms often accompany the P0506 code in Audis:

  • Rough Idle: The engine may vibrate or shake noticeably when idling.
  • Low Idle Speed: The RPM gauge will show a lower than normal reading at idle.
  • Engine Stalling: In severe cases, the engine may stall, especially when coming to a stop.
  • Misfires: Low idle and lean air-fuel mixtures can sometimes cause engine misfires.
  • Poor Cold Starts: Starting the engine, especially when cold, might be difficult.

These symptoms can vary in severity depending on the underlying cause of the P0506 code.

Potential Causes of P0506 Code in Audi

Several factors can contribute to a P0506 code in Audi vehicles. Diagnosing the root cause requires a systematic approach. Here are some common culprits:

  1. Vacuum Leaks: Leaks in vacuum lines, intake manifold gaskets, or other vacuum-operated components can allow unmetered air to enter the engine, leading to a lean air-fuel mixture and low idle.

  2. Dirty or Faulty Throttle Body: Carbon buildup on the throttle body or a malfunctioning electronic throttle body can impede proper airflow control and affect idle speed.

  3. Faulty Mass Air Flow (MAF) Sensor: An inaccurate MAF sensor reading can lead to incorrect fuel calculations and idle speed issues.

  4. PCV Valve Problems: A malfunctioning PCV valve can cause vacuum leaks or incorrect crankcase pressure, disrupting idle. As noted in the original post, checking PCV valve functionality is important.

  5. Diagnosing the P0506 Code in Your Audi

Troubleshooting a P0506 code requires a methodical approach. Here are steps you can take:

  1. OBD-II Scan: Use an OBD-II scanner, like VCDS (VAG-COM Diagnostic System) mentioned in the original post, to confirm the P0506 code and check for any other related codes (like misfire codes, P0016, P050A, as seen in the original post). Clear the codes and see if P0506 returns.

  2. Visual Inspection for Vacuum Leaks: Carefully inspect all vacuum lines, hoses, and intake manifold areas for cracks, loose connections, or damage. Listen for hissing sounds that might indicate a vacuum leak.

  3. Throttle Body Inspection and Cleaning: Examine the throttle body for carbon buildup. Clean the throttle body using a throttle body cleaner and a soft cloth. Be careful not to damage any electronic components.

Repairing the P0506 Code

The repair for a P0506 code depends entirely on the identified root cause. Common repairs may include:

  • Vacuum Leak Repair: Replacing cracked or damaged vacuum lines, intake manifold gaskets, or other components causing vacuum leaks.
  • Throttle Body Cleaning or Replacement: Cleaning carbon buildup from the throttle body or replacing a faulty electronic throttle body.
  • MAF Sensor Replacement: Replacing a faulty MAF sensor.
  • PCV Valve Replacement: Replacing a malfunctioning PCV valve.
  • Timing Adjustment or Repair: Correcting engine timing issues, which might involve timing chain or component repairs in more complex cases.
  • Wiring or Connector Repair: Addressing any wiring or connector issues related to sensors or actuators in the idle control system.
  • ECU Reprogramming or Replacement: In rare cases, ECU reprogramming or replacement might be necessary.

After performing any repairs, clear the P0506 code with an OBD-II scanner and monitor if it returns. Test drive the vehicle to ensure the idle issue is resolved and that no other symptoms persist.
